crucian carp
noun cru·cian carp \ˈkrü-shən-\
Definition of CRUCIAN CARP
: a European cyprinid fish (Carassius carassius) —called also crucian

Origin of CRUCIAN CARP
modification of Low German karuse, from Middle Low German karusse, perhaps of Baltic origin; akin to Lithuanian karušis carp
